Abstract

Violence against women has increasingly been the focus of research, assessment and intervention in Portugal. In spite of the growing commitment of the public and the private sector, of the police, education, local and city councils, courts, health centres, mass media and institutions, violence against women is still a current problem. In this article the prevalence data regarding violence against women in Portugal will be discussed and the mechanisms to tackle this situation including governmental policies and strategies, and the interventions developed at the national level and the role of UMAR (No Governmental Organization, with public status) in defences of women’s rights.
